Effects of Mentoring on the Employment Experiences and Career Satisfaction of Women Student Affairs Administrators.
Blackhurst, Anne
NASPA Journal, v37 n4 p573-86 Sum 2000
Surveys women student affairs administrators to determine the relationships between mentoring and role conflict, role ambiguity, organizational commitment, career satisfaction, and perceived sex discrimination. Results indicate mentoring may benefit White women and women of color in different ways, and may result in reduced role conflict and ambiguity, as well as increased organizational commitment.
